Les Dames d'Escoffier Washington DC - Community Grants Program
Geographic Scope: Washington, D.C. metropolitan area and surrounding regions (Maryland, Virginia, Delaware)
Funder: Les Dames d'Escoffier Washington, D.C. Regional Chapter,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ization
Mission: Dedicated to empowering the next generation of culinary and hospitality professionals while supporting impactful community initiatives through a robust grants and scholarships program.
Funding Focus
Each year, grants are awarded to tax-exempt charitable or educational organizations making a significant difference in the community through food and hospitality. Funded initiatives support:
- Community health through food and nutrition education
- Sustainable food practices and food equity
- Culinary education and workforce development
- Food justice initiatives
- Programs serving underserved and low-income communities, particularly women and youth
- Food entrepreneurship and business development for low-income entrepreneurs
- Food access for food-insecure populations
- Hospitality and food service worker training and professional credentialing
Award Amounts
Historical awards range from $1,500 to $5,000 per grant. Most recent awards (2025) were $5,000.
Eligibility
- Organization Type: Tax-exempt charitable or educational organizations only
- Geographic Preference: D.C. area and surrounding Baltimore-Washington region
- Mission Alignment: Must demonstrate commitment to food, beverage, hospitality, education, and philanthropy

Recent Grant Recipients (2025)
Additional Recipient Examples
2024: Dreaming Out Loud, Inc. (women food entrepreneurs), The Family Place (hospitality worker credentialing), Horizons of Kent and Queen Anne's (youth nutrition education)
2023: After School All Stars (cooking/nutrition classes), Four Eleven Kitchen (community teaching garden), Baltimore Outreach Services (life skills cooking for homeless women), Dog Tag Inc. (veterans culinary training)
2022: La Cocina VA (culinary training and small business incubator), Feed the Fridge (fresh meal distribution)
2021-2020: Community Bridges, Baltimore Outreach Services, La Cocina VA
- February 28: Grant application deadline
- March - Early April: Grants Committee reviews applications and conducts due diligence
- April 13: Grants committee submits recommendations to Board for approval
- Mid-April: Notification of grant award or decline
- Late April - Early May: Grant funds distributed
- December: Grant awardees provide 6-month update on funded program
